Unlocking User Engagement: Best Practices for Website Design

Crafting a compelling website experience that draws in users is crucial for success in today's digital landscape. Effective website design goes beyond aesthetics; it prioritizes on user experience. By implementing best practices, you can foster an environment that stimulates active participation and involvement.

Focus on a clear and concise structure to guide users effortlessly through your website. Employ intuitive navigation menus that are easily accessible, allowing visitors to seamlessly find the information they require.

Enhance your website for mobile devices, as a significant portion of users browse websites on smartphones and tablets. A responsive design ensures a consistent user experience across all platforms.

Incorporate high-quality visuals, read more such as images and videos, to captivate users and communicate your message effectively. Visual content can enhance text-based information and make your website more memorable.

Embed interactive elements, such as quizzes, polls, or forms, to prompt user participation and gather valuable insights. Interactive content promotes engagement and can yield actionable data about your audience.

Nurture a sense of community by promoting user interaction through comments, forums, or social media integration. A engaged community can strengthen brand loyalty and foster long-term relationships with your audience.

Periodically monitor website traffic and user behavior to discover areas for improvement. A data-driven approach allows you to make informed decisions that optimize the user experience and drive engagement.

Creating a Winning Website: A Step-by-Step Guide

Crafting a captivating website isn't just about aesthetics; it's a strategic process that demands careful development from conception to launch. Begin your journey by establishing your target audience and their needs. Conduct thorough research to understand their preferences, behaviors, and motivations.

Develop a comprehensive website plan that outlines your goals, key elements, and desired user experience. Craft compelling text that is both informative and engaging, optimized for search engines and maximum visibility.

Design a user-friendly layout that navigates visitors seamlessly through your site. Choose a color scheme and typography that reflect your brand identity while remaining legible. Ensure your website is fully responsive, providing an optimal viewing experience across all devices.

Finally, refine your website rigorously to identify and resolve any potential issues before deploying it to the world.

Responsive Design: Ensuring Seamless Experiences Across Devices

In today's digital landscape, users utilize the web on a wide range of devices. From smartphones and tablets to laptops and desktops, the screen resolutions can significantly differ. This is where responsive design comes into play, ensuring that websites adjust seamlessly to any screen size, providing an optimal user experience no matter the device.

Responsive design employs a set of techniques to accomplish this goal. These include using adjustable layouts, CSS media rules, and efficient images. By implementing these strategies, web designers can build websites that are viewable on any device, encouraging user engagement and satisfaction.

A responsive design methodology not only enhances the user experience but also has several advantages.

* It raises website traffic as more users can easily visit the site.

* It improves SEO rankings as search engines prefer mobile-friendly websites.

* It lowers bounce rates as users are less likely to leave a site that is easy to navigate and read.
